1Use Past Clients
Congrats if you are already making money online as a writer! That’s a big feat! What you can do know is leverage the clients you already have for more work and income.
Referral business is the best way to gain high-paying clients and boost your income to help you work from home. Bloggers online have network of other bloggers doing the same things.
Those other bloggers probably need writing too. If you can get in your client’s circle, there will be no shortage of work. This has happened to me several times and it’s a passive way and easy way to make money fast.
2. Use Other Freelance Writers
Now, what if you don’t have any freelance writing clients? What do you do then? Well, why not use other freelance writers?
They may need to sub contract work or they may have jobs for you!
Other freelance writers can also help you with your writing skills too. Both of you can edit each other’s writing or help improve each other’s writing!
In any case, you have to think about this as not a competitive industry. Other bloggers or other freelancers can help you with making money online.

4. Cold Pitch
Cold pitching is the idea of finding a business online and pitching directly to them that you’re a freelance writer for hire. This business isn’t actively seeking a content writer, so your email is a cold email.
Many writers have had great success in making money fast this way. Course student Teresa was laid off the prior month, but was able to generate $3650 in cold pitching!
